Join the Thabazimbi Blood Drive!

Thabazimbi – This Valentine’s season, the South African National Blood Service (SANBS) invites the community to give the most meaningful gift of all — the gift of life. On Wednesday, 5 February 2025, a blood drive will be held at the NG Church in 10th Avenue, Thabazimbi, from 14:00 to 18:00. The dedicated SANBS team will be traveling all the way from Rustenburg to make this life-saving initiative possible — thank you for your commitment!

“As we celebrate Valentine’s Day, it’s an opportunity to reflect on how we can extend our love beyond our immediate circles and make a difference in the lives of others,” says Rustenburg SANBS clinic supervisor Tshegofatso Mulwane. “I will be in Thabazimbi on Wednesday, and I encourage the community to come and donate. The process takes only a few minutes, and every donation can help save lives.”

First-time donor John Selomolela shared his experience: “I was nervous at first, but then I realised that I am doing this to save lives. I will definitely donate again to help those in need.”

This February, let’s go beyond flowers and chocolates — let’s spread kindness, hope, and life. Whether you’re a regular donor or considering it for the first time, your donation can change lives. Join the SANBS blood drive and be a hero in someone’s story!

Photo: LIFE IN EVERY DROP! Blood donor John Selomolela donates blood under the expert care of Rustenburg SANBS donor care officer Karabo Kotsedi. Together, they are making a life-saving difference.
